    Default exhaust rasp - HELP

    Hello everyone

    iv got a V6 2010 camaro, just finished getting long tube headers installed, already had a cat back system. not the car is loud and has a major annoying rasp when accelerating. cruise is nice and smooth.

    need some suggestions.

    i was thinking of installing 2 Vibrant ultraquiet resonators, or 2 Twister race mufflers.

    what would you recomend, even something different would be great as long as it works.

    i really dont want to have to put the stock headers and cats back on but it may be the only way.

    sugestions please.
